  Geodetically Inferred Locking State of the Cascadia Megathrust Based on a Viscoelastic Earth Model

Li, S., Wang, K., Wang, Y., Jiang, Y., Dosso, S. E. (2018): Geodetically Inferred Locking State of the Cascadia Megathrust Based on a Viscoelastic Earth Model. - Journal of Geophysical Research, 123, 9, 8056-8072.
https://doi.org/10.1029/2018JB015620
